Agriculture today faces chronic labor shortages and growing challenges around herbicide resistance, as well as consumer backlash to chemical inputs. Smarter, more sustainable approaches are needed to secure the ongoing production of fresh produce within the United States. In this session, Xiong Chang, CEO of Tensorfield Agriculture, will introduce his company’s unique robot, which uses high-speed computer vision to enable extremely precise, pesticide-free robotic weeding. He’ll also highlight some of the key challenges his team faced in developing the robot. He’ll explain Tensorfield’s business model and show how its technology has the potential to save millions of dollars in labor and material costs for some of the largest growers in the United States. And he’ll share how Tensorfield plans to scale its business.
